Title

Falling Into Your Grace

Main Information and Key Points

  • God’s compassion is given freely, without compromise; His kindness covers what I cannot forgive on my own.
  • Each time I stumble, I “fall into Your grace,” discovering a clearer view of Your strength.
  • Jesus lifts me up in love, removes my sin, and claims me as His own.
  • I invite Him to shatter my pride, break down my walls, repair my broken life, and restore my weary soul.
  • There is no limit to His love or to the renewal He works within me; He continually makes me new.

Personal Reflection and Application

  • I recognize that failure is never the end—every fall becomes another encounter with God’s restoring grace.
  • Remembering there is “no limit” to His love encourages me to release pride and allow Him to rebuild the areas of my life that feel fractured or exhausted.
  • Daily, I can confess my need, receive His lifting love, and walk forward in the freedom Jesus provides.

Summary

This devotional centers on the boundless grace and limitless love of Jesus. Whenever I fail, He meets me with compassion, lifts me in love, and renews my life. Embracing this truth invites continual surrender of pride and deeper dependence on His strength, leading to ongoing restoration and freedom in Christ.
